Best upgrade for a spyder = a better marker altogether.
But, if you're adamant about "upgrading" what you have, there are a few simple things you can do.
Polish the internals - better gas efficiency, better velocity consistency and less friction on the parts. It can be done with toothpaste, but I would recommend lapping compound if you've some handy.
Lighten the hammer - better gas efficiency, less valve bounce, etc.
Lighten the trigger/decrease stroke length - easily done with a drilled and tapped set screw or two and some tweaking of the springs, polishing of contact areas, etc.
Milling/ano/cosmetic changes? What gas are you running? Do you have a good reg?
And even after all that, you still have a spyder. Honestly, when all is said and done, you're better off getting a good marker to start with.
